Job Description:
The postdoctoral researchers will work on an ERC related project focusing on the expression of endoplasmic reticulum export site components at mitochondria to recreate an ERES related structure at mitochondria. Responsibilities include working with a team on mechanisms by which cells secrete bulky cargoes like collagens, mucins, and chylomicrons, utilizing in vitro and in vivo analyses. The candidates will contribute to structural and functional analyses of key components such as TANGO1 and aim to visualize and characterize the route taken by bulky cargoes for their export from the ER.
